Object Name | Mug | |
Culture | Ancestral Pueblo (Anasazi) | |
Global Region | North America | |
Country | USA | |
State/Prov./Dist. | New Mexico | |
County | San Juan | |
Other Geographic Data | Halfway up Little Shiprock Wash | |
Maker's Name | Unknown | |
Date of Manufacture | ca. 1100-1300 CE | |
Collection Name | Elkus Collection (Native American) | |
Materials | Clay; Vegetal paint | |
Description | Mesa Verde black-on-white round mug with flat base and inward sloping sides; Rim form is everted with rounded lip; Coiled handle attached at rim and at base; Interior is scraped smooth; Exterior is scraped smooth, polished and slipped white, then painted with horizontal band divided into 5 panels, each containing a wide negative zigzag line, framed above and below by series of wide and narrow parallel lines; Band of dots encircle lip and 3 columns of dots cover handle. | |
Dimensions (cm) | Height = 10.5, Depth = 13.8, Rim Diam = 8.8, Max Diam = 11.3 |
